The offerings for the Mid-Autumn Festival in English are "the offerings for the Mid-Autumn Festival" or "the sacrificial items for the Mid-Autumn Festival." Here are some common traditional offerings:

1. Mooncakes: Round pastries filled with sweet or savory ingredients, symbolizing the full moon.
2. Tea: A pot of tea is often offered to the moon god, as well as to guests.
3. Fruit: Assorted fruits, particularly those that are round or resemble the moon, like watermelons, grapes, and pomelos.
4. Chrysanthemum tea: A traditional Chinese tea that is believed to help clear the mind and enhance longevity.
5. Incense: Burnt to create a pleasing aroma and to honor the moon god.
